It's kind of an unofficial family tradition I guess, and it probably has a lot to do with holding onto collegiate days. I'm not sure if any other families in my chapter did this, but some of the girls in my family started wearing something besides their lavalier when they began their senior year, as did some other girls in other families. I gave mine to my second little at our senior ceremony when I graduated since she still had two years to go. Normally in my chapter though, your Berry Buddy is supposed to buy it for you when you get initiated, but I knew I would be graduating the semester I took my second little so I never got her a Berry Buddy (lazy senioritis perhaps). Your Berry Buddy is selected by your big and does a little clue thing during Link Week (week prior to initiation) and right after you're initiated and get your gifts from your big, your Berry Buddy reveals herself by giving you your lavalier. Your Berry Buddy is someone that is close to your Big and is supposed to serve as a sort of surrogate Big if you're ever not available for her. It's usually someone not in your family (though I suppose it could be, especially in my case since my two littles got so close they won Frick and Frack after I left).
